Just bought new house with 3 acres of flat lawn. I realize that commercial ZTRs are the way to go, but they are about $3,000 out of reach. Veering toward the Exmark Pioneer 60" with Kohler. $500 instant rebate and extended warranty. The dealer close to my house has a great reputation. Any advice would be appreciated. I'm new to the whole lawn mower/zero turn thing. My limit is $7,000, the pioneer after instant rebate will be $6,779, an even 7 with mulch kit attached. Thanks!

it is a total beast i wish i had a 60 insted of the 72 two dealers had one each and the 60 was 1500 more then the 72 and the 72 had 500 less hours so i went with it but you need to go out and measure to see if it will fit and how much clearance you will have remember the cut is 60" but the deck is going to be a few inches bigger

also if your getting it from a dealer and im sure you are ask him if you can have him drop it off so you can try it out im sure he will if he wants to make a sale most of them will that way you can see if it will fit what you need
